If you want to do it yourself, I highly recommend Optimizely. You can find a lot of resources around the web on tests to try, and with Optimizely, you can implement them yourself. I use it everyday, and implementing and running tests is a breeze.

You may also want to check out http://www.hiconversion.com/, you can sign up for their demo here: http://www.hiconversion.com/resources/white-papers/ and I believe SiteTuners goes through Optimizely - they host a webinar every few days or so https://www.optimizely.com/resources/live-demo-webinar. I'm exploring them for the first time myself, however the demo I watched for HiConversion was pretty impressive. They give you great real time results and their API automatically adjusts itself based on favorable conversion results. Both Optimizely and HiConversion seem pretty easy to figure out and implement as well.
